Transaction 417631b5e812e33bcf3d81d151afa96d369c15015fb8649aa6123bf635327351

2 Input
2 Outputs
  • 417631b5e812e33bcf3d81d151afa96d369c15015fb8649aa6123bf635327351:0
  • value  8419245
    address  1McATDNhqWvwCdzFUFF1JZ6HL5CKZ4xCPL
  • 417631b5e812e33bcf3d81d151afa96d369c15015fb8649aa6123bf635327351:1
  • value  399004
    address  35SEhKv8tzcjDiwriVJsopTPXTqVKhP8Cn